Did you notice our ads, PR, or events ?
Please let us know. As our ads appear during the
implementation of our
2004
marketing plan, we will list them here to identify our current choices
of media placements and timing. The tables below will highlight the
current participants, who will also be featured in special pages designed to
accompany each media selection (specific magazine, website, etc.).
Ads will follow a consistent design across all similar
media (like brand campaigns), but highlight different participants
according to their media placement preferences.
Our 2004 ads
will not resemble our simple 2003 ads, which were aimed at a very different
audience through other media for our business launch purposes. They
served that purpose, but our 2004 campaign now has very different objectives
to reinforce our direct contact and relationship development work among
executives and make it very easy for executives to respond directly to the
participants in this service, or to find and respond indirectly to any of
the participants in this advertising, PR, and event work through this
website or our personal contact and referral work.
For example, an area may want to participate in 10 of 30
placements during the year, perhaps concentrating on 3 or 4 media out of 10
in the overall campaign, based upon their own marketing strategy and
resources. They can benefit from responses to the entire campaign,
however, rather than just the placements in which they appear.
The above example doesn't reflect our actual media plan
for cooperative ads in 2004, which will (as the name suggests) be developed
in cooperation with the participants. The same process applies for
other types of PR or event work we may undertake. |

| Explanation of this section The main focus of our work,
as explained separately, is to develop relationships with top executives and
their advisors through personal contact work, and refer them to the
information resources and professionals who can help them with their plans.
To achieve that objective, however, we also plan to
complement our direct contact work with general marketing and networking
activities, including advertising, PR work, special events, and other
channels to reach more of the executives we can serve.
This section will highlight economic development
organizations and professional services providers which have chosen to
participate in such marketing activities to quickly reach more executives
together who may value their capabilities.
We welcome suggestions to improve the effectiveness of this marketing
investment at efficiently reaching more top executives who could take
advantage of these services.
